Two Lankans arrested with foreign currency worth Rs.3 million

Two Sri Lankans have been arrested by custom officials at the Katunayake International Airport while they had been attempting to smuggle foreign currency in a flight from Sri Lanka to Bangkok yesterday (December 25) evening.


Following the arrest stacks of foreign currency including 26 300 US Dollars, 5 920 Thai Baht and also 1175 Chinese Yuan were recovered from the suspects.


The total currency notes amounts to over 3 million Lankan Rupees, Airport Customs Director Parakrama Basnayake told Ada Derana. The arrested suspects are said to be residents of Colombo and Kandy.
